Left Side of the Plane

The left side of the aircraft offers a front-row seat to the most dramatic sections of the Alps, including the Julian Alps in Slovenia and the high glaciated peaks of the Austrian Hohe Tauern range.

Book a seat on the left to witness the sun setting behind the Alps on evening flights. Avoid sitting over the wing to ensure an unobstructed view of the high-altitude glaciers in Austria. The descent usually passes right by the Karwendel mountains, offering excellent photo opportunities of the rock faces.

The right side is preferable for morning flights to avoid direct sun glare while photographing the landscape. It offers better views of the Pannonian plains and the suburban sprawl of Munich. Watch for Chiemsee about 15 minutes before landing as a key landmark.
